Buying a Portable Air Conditioner? Here’s What It Should Have

When shopping for the best portable air conditioner, certain features should be a given—ensuring you get a reliable, efficient, and user-friendly unit. Here’s what to expect:

Essential Features (Must-Haves)

  • Cooling Capacity (BTU Rating): Higher BTU means better cooling for larger rooms. Ensure the unit suits your space size.
  • Energy Efficiency: Look for an A-rated or higher energy-efficient model to reduce electricity costs.
  • Dehumidification Function: Helps remove excess moisture, improving comfort and preventing mould growth.
  • Ventilation & Exhaust System: Comes with a window kit for proper venting and heat expulsion.
  • Adjustable Fan Speeds: At least two to three-speed settings for flexible airflow control.
  • Self-Evaporating System: Reduces or eliminates the need to manually drain water from condensation.
  • Noise Level: Ranges from 50-65 dB, similar to a conversation or standard fan. Lower noise levels are ideal for bedrooms and offices.

Design and Build Quality

A well-built portable air conditioner should be durable, easy to move, and designed for hassle-free use. Here’s what to check:

  • Compact & Lightweight Design: Ideal for small spaces and easy storage when not in use.
  • Omnidirectional Wheels: Ensures smooth movement between rooms without heavy lifting.
  • Sturdy Build: Avoid cheap plastic casing—high-quality materials improve longevity.
  • Simple Setup: A quick and secure window installation kit should be included.

Extra Features That Elevate Cooling Efficiency

Some additional features can enhance the overall experience, making operation more convenient:

  • Sleep Mode: Lowers noise and adjusts temperature gradually for nighttime comfort.
  • Remote Control & Digital Display: For effortless operation and precise temperature control.
  • 24-Hour Timer: Allows scheduled cooling to optimise energy usage.
  • Smart Home Integration: Some models connect to Wi-Fi or voice assistants for remote control.
  • Swing Mode (Oscillation): Distributes airflow evenly across the room for better cooling.
  • Multi-Functionality (4-in-1): Includes cooling, dehumidifying, fan, and sometimes heating for year-round use.

By considering these factors, you’ll ensure you choose a portable air conditioner that is efficient, durable and meets your cooling needs without unnecessary compromises.

How We Tested and Chose the Best Portable Air Conditioners

Finding the best portable air conditioner requires more than just switching on a unit and feeling the breeze. We carefully examined each model based on cooling performance, energy efficiency, ease of use, noise levels, and overall value. Here’s how we did it.

Cooling Performance

To assess how well each unit cooled a space, we measured the starting room temperature before switching the air conditioner on. We tested each model in a room size suited to its BTU rating, running it for 30 to 60 minutes while tracking temperature drops at multiple points.

The best units cooled the space quickly and maintained an even temperature without hot spots. We also compared how long it took each air conditioner to lower the temperature by 5–10°C, ensuring consistency in cooling power.

Energy Efficiency

Cooling effectiveness is important, but not at the expense of high electricity bills. Using a power meter, we recorded how much energy each unit consumed per hour, factoring in its cooling capacity.

We also tested eco-modes and energy-saving features to see if they made a noticeable difference in consumption without sacrificing cooling performance. Models that adjusted automatically to room conditions stood out for efficiency.

Noise Levels

A portable air conditioner should keep you cool without being disruptive. We measured noise output at both one and three meters away in different settings, including standard cooling mode and sleep mode.

For context, anything below 50 dB is considered quiet, 50–65 dB is typical, and above 65 dB starts to feel intrusive. We also checked for unexpected rattling, vibrations, or sudden loud cycling that could be distracting over time.

Ease of Use and Installation

Setting up a portable air conditioner shouldn’t be a struggle. We unpacked and installed each unit, noting whether the included window kit fits standard UK windows without modifications. The controls were tested for ease of use, ensuring the digital display, buttons, and remote were intuitive.

Mobility was another factor—we checked how smoothly the wheels moved and whether repositioning the unit required effort. For models with water tanks, we assessed how easy they were to drain and clean.

Dehumidification Performance

Since many portable air conditioners also function as dehumidifiers, we tested their ability to reduce humidity in damp conditions. Before turning each unit on, we recorded the room’s humidity levels and then measured them again after an hour of operation.

The best models noticeably improved air quality and collected a significant amount of moisture, making them useful beyond just cooling.

Extra Features and Smart Functions

Some models offer added convenience through smart features, so we tested their practicality. Remote controls were evaluated for full functionality rather than just basic power and fan adjustments.

Units with Wi-Fi or smart home compatibility were set up with apps or voice assistants to see how seamlessly they integrated. We also looked at timers, sleep modes, and oscillation settings, checking if they improved user experience or felt like unnecessary add-ons.

Overall Value for Money

Once all tests were completed, we compared each air conditioner based on performance, efficiency, usability, and additional features. We considered whether the price justified the unit’s capabilities, ensuring that budget-friendly options still delivered reliable cooling.

A higher price tag needed to be backed by standout features and long-term durability.


Frequently Asked Questions

Is It Worth Getting a Portable Air Conditioner in the UK?

Yes, it is worth getting a modern portable air conditioner in the UK, especially during increasingly warm summers. While the UK climate is generally mild, heatwaves can make indoor spaces uncomfortable.

A portable air conditioner provides targeted cooling warm air, making it a practical solution for homes without built-in air conditioning.

Is It OK to Run a Portable AC All Night?

Yes, it is OK to run a portable air conditioning unit all night, but it depends on the model’s noise level and energy efficiency. Many units have sleep modes that reduce fan speed and noise for overnight comfort. However, running it continuously may increase electricity costs and require regular maintenance.

Do Portable ACs Waste a Lot of Electricity?

Portable air conditioners do consume electricity, but whether they waste it depends on efficiency ratings and usage. Models with energy-saving features, such as eco mode and programmable timers, help reduce power consumption.

Choosing the right BTU rating for the room size prevents excessive energy use while ensuring effective cooling.

Will a Portable AC Cool a Bedroom?

Yes, a portable air conditioner cools a bedroom effectively if it is properly sized for the space. Choosing a unit with the right BTU rating ensures sufficient cooling without overworking the system.

Features like sleep mode and adjustable airflow improve comfort while maintaining energy efficiency in a bedroom setting.

Where Is the Best Place to Put a Portable Air Conditioner?

The best place to put a portable air conditioner is near a window for proper venting and in an area with unobstructed airflow. Positioning it centrally in the room helps distribute cool air evenly. Avoid placing it near heat sources or in direct sunlight to maintain optimal performance and efficiency.

Can a Portable AC Overheat?

Yes, a portable air conditioner can overheat if airflow is blocked, filters are dirty, or ventilation is inadequate. Overheating can also occur if the unit runs continuously without proper maintenance.

Regularly cleaning filters, ensuring proper venting, and allowing cool-down periods can prevent overheating and prolong the unit’s lifespan.
